This episode had some good points, but it was a little...weird. Keeping the whole "cure the Prince with happiness" plot feels out of place in PR, but fits in perfectly with the Megaforce worldview, which just seems to show how much Megaforce disassociates itself with the rest of PR in general, despite all of its "valiant" efforts. I will admit that showing more of the monster in original footage to better replicate the Gokaiger counterpart was a step in the right direction because it showed a one episode villain doing and saying something. The original footage of the Megazord's internal compartments didn't look all that terrible either. However, Emma's plan feels a little too contrived here, not just "elaborate." Unfortunately, I think Emma gets the short-end of a very low-end product. Her lines just feel weak and seem to be pandering to modern-day censors and needless exposition. The Dino Thunder usage felt rather random here, like most of the other Legendary Ranger Morphs. There was no build-up to it at all. It would have been nice if there was at least a "Mighty Morphin" change to Pink by Emma because it would have started the whole "Go to the Dinos" instead of the whole "Let's do this as a team since we haven't done so yet" DT morph. I felt like Emma could have done something else rather than making a kid's kite fly. The episode's title "United as One" only seems to reference the inevitable arm-switching, "all six in the same cockpit" part of the plot. The good parts of this episode were more isolated than necessary here. Dino Charge should not have to suffer from this, and I hope DC Pink isn't forced to make a lot out of ABSOLUTELY NOTHING!!!
